Ingredients
  

For Sautéed Yellow Squash

  • 2 medium yellow squash, sliced ¼ inch thick
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il or butter
  • 3 cloves garlic, minced
  • to taste Salt
  • to taste Black pepper
  • optional Fresh parsley or basil for garnish

For Yellow Squash Stir-Fry

  • 2 medium yellow squash, sliced
  • 1 bell pepper sliced
  • 1 cup broccoli florets
  • 2 tablespoons soy sauce
  • 1 tablespoon sesame oil
  • 1 teaspoon fresh ginger, grated
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ced

For Baked Yellow Squash Chips

  • 2 medium yellow squash
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• ½ teaspoon sea salt
  • ½ teaspoon garlic powder
  • ½ teaspoon paprika

For Yellow Squash Noodles

  • 2 medium yellow squash
  • 2 medium zucchini
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• 1 cup cherry tomatoes, halved
  • ¼ cup fresh basil, chopped
  • ¼ cup Parmesan cheese, grated
  • to taste Salt, pepper, and garlic powder

For Stuffed Yellow Squash Boats

  • 4 medium yellow squash
  • 1 pound ground turkey or beef
  • 1 onion chopped
  • 1 bell pepper diced
  • 1 cup cooked quinoa or rice
  • 1 teaspoon Italian seasoning
  • 1 cup shredded mozzarella or cheddar

For Yellow Squash Casserole

  • 4 medium yellow squash, sliced
  • 1 onion chopped
  • ½ cup milk
  • 1 can cream of mushroom soup (or make white sauce)
  • 1 cup breadcrumbs or crushed crackers
  • 1 cup cheddar cheese, shredded
  • 3 tablespoons butter, melted

Instructions
 

For Sautéed Yellow Squash

  • Heat o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at.
  • Add garlic and cook for 30 seconds until fragrant.
  • Add squash slices in a single layer.
  • Cook for 3-4 minutes without moving, allowing them to get golden brown.
  • Flip and cook another 2-3 minutes.
  • Season with salt and pepper.
  • Garnish with herbs if desired.

For Yellow Squash Stir-Fry

  • Heat sesame oil in a wok or large pan over high heat.
  • Add ginger and garlic, and stir for 30 seconds.
  • Add broccoli and stir-fry for 2 minutes.
  • Add bell peppers and squash; cook another 3-4 minutes until tender-crisp.
  • Add soy sauce and toss to coat. Serve over rice or noodles.

For Baked Yellow Squash Chips

  • Slice squash paper-thin using a mandoline slicer.
  • Toss with oil and seasonings.
  • Arrange in a single layer on baking sheets lined with parchment.
  • Bake at 225°F for 2-2.5 hours, flipping halfway.
  • Let chips cool to crisp up, then store in an airtight container.

For Yellow Squash Noodles

  • Spiralize squash and zucchini, salt heavily, and let drain in a colander for 20 minutes.
  • Squeeze out liquid in towels.
  • Heat oil in a large pan, add tomatoes, and cook for 2 minutes.
  • Add noodles and toss for 2-3 minutes just to heat through.
  • Remove from heat, add basil and Parmesan, and season to taste.

For Stuffed Yellow Squash Boats

  • Cut squash in half lengthwise and scoop out seeds.
  • Cook ground meat with onion and bell pepper until browned.
  • Stir in quinoa, chopped squash flesh, and Italian seasoning.
  • Fill squash halves with mixture and top with cheese.
  • Bake at 375°F for 25-30 minutes until squash is tender and cheese melts.

For Yellow Squash Casserole

  • Boil squash and onion for 5 minutes until tender, then drain well.
  • Mix eggs, milk, soup, and half the cheese.
  • Fold in squash and pour into a greased 9x13 dish.
  • Mix breadcrumbs, remaining cheese, and melted butter; sprinkle over top.
  • Bake at 350°F for 30-35 minutes until bubbly and golden.

Notes

Always salt and drain yellow squash to avoid watery dishes. Use high heat for cooking to develop flavor through browning. Pair with strong flavors for best results.
